Output 4090c86ab5b2753640655160ef84325f19c8d5a14bddb7259b99c44edfdbeaa1:19

value
145720
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bb3d84e139fd74d5854428751a91fa221cc121b8 OP_EQUAL
address
3Jm3yqQV3JBVZFZJUffqK5DVZpEToi4VCx
transaction
4090c86ab5b2753640655160ef84325f19c8d5a14bddb7259b99c44edfdbeaa1
spent
true